Among the city's most popular tourist attractions are Bellingrath Gardens and Home, antebellum home Oakleigh Mansion, Cox-Deasy Cottage Museum and Battleship USS Alabama. Fort Conde is a partial replica of an original 18th-century French fort. Fort Gaines is the battle site of the famed Battle of the Bay in August 1864. Mobile is the birthplace of the USA's Mardi Gras (aka America's Family Mardi Gras). It is located on Mobile Bay (Gulf of Mexico's inlet) which is formed by Fort Morgan Peninsula (on the east) and Dauphin Island (on the west). The city covers an area of approx 413 km2 (159 mi2) and has population around 195,000 (metro around 415,000).

In 2004, the new cruise terminal was opened, costingsomewhere between $10 and $20 million. It was the home port of Carnival’s Holidaycruise ship with itineraries mainly to Mexico showing 100% capacity. Unfortunately, Mobile cruise terminal has no facilities forstoring luggage. If you arrive at the terminal before check-in has opened youronly options are to leave your luggage in the car while you head into downtownfor refreshments, or take your luggage with you.

An enclosed walkway/ramp leads fromsecurity and check-in directly onto the ship. Mobile Alabama Cruise Terminal is a 66,000 ft2 (6,130 m2) sized cruise ship facility with top-notch security, dedicated cruise parking area and covered lanes serving passenger pickup / drop off vehicles. The cruise ship terminal building is located in downtown Mobile City, in close proximity to hotels and restaurants. The cruise ship terminal has a limited supply of wheelchairs for transporting passengers on and off the ship only. Carnival has wheelchairs available on a first-come, first-served basis, which should be requested from Carnival staff upon arrival at the terminal and cannot be borrowed for the duration of the cruise. After a flood in 1723, the French rebuilt the fort on Mobile Bay to serve as the area's main defense point until 1820. The fort was opened in 1976 as part of the nation's bicentennial celebration.
The port is located 59 miles west of Pensacola on theFlorida Panhandle and a similar distance east of Biloxi, Mississippi. It isconnected to both these major cities by the Interstate 10 highway. Mobile AL was ranked USA's 4th largest coal export port for 2012, with the majority of the exports being shipped to Europe and South America. And while no one would ever mistake Mobile’s operations with the major cruising ports seen in other cities, it does offer a convenient location with a newer terminal and regular cruises to points in Mexico. More recently, Carnival signed a 3-year agreement withMobile Port with plans to relocate the Carnival Fascination to the portin January 2022. She will replace the Fantasy, which is thought to beretiring from the fleet. This all looks good for the future of Carnival cruisescontinuing to use Mobile cruise terminal as a flourishing home port. Carnival also offers one-time adventure cruises from Mobile,AL including a 10-day Panama Canal cruise.
